接受一组断言,并返回一个函数" f",如果所有组成断言针对所有参数返回逻辑真值,则返回true,否则返回false。
every-pred - 语法
(every-pred p1 p2 .. pn)
参数 - 'p1 p2 ... pn'是需要测试的所有断言的列表。
every-pred - 示例
(ns clojure.examples.example (:gen-class)) (defn Example [] (println ((every-pred number? even?) 2 4 6)) (println ((every-pred number? odd?) 2 4 6))) (Example)
上面的程序产生以下输出。
true false
参考链接
https://www.learnfk.com/clojure/clojure-predicates-everypred.html
标签:返回,false,断言,pred,无涯,every,clojure From: https://blog.51cto.com/u_14033984/8067936